Remarks

PREFERRED RWY IS RWY 21; FOR NOISE ABATEMENT WHEN DEP RWY 03 MAINT RWY HDG TIL 2 NM N OF ARPT.
SPECIALIZED ACFT (ULTRALGT, HOMEBUILT, ETC) CTC AMGR 814-793-2027 OR UNICOM PRIOR TO LDG.
RWY/TWY CONDITIONS UNMONITORED OUTSIDE OF NML ATTENDANCE HRS.
FOR CD CTC JOHNSTOWN APCH AT 814-532-5960, WHEN APCH CLSD CTC CLEVELAND ARTCC AT 440-774-0213.
EXCP FOR TAXI, RWY 12/30 NOT AVBL FOR SKED ACR OPNS WITH MORE THAN 9 PAX AND UNSKED FOR ACR OPNS WITH MORE THAN 30 PAX.
RWY 03/2 1 RY 03/21, THRESHOLD LGTS & EDGE LGTS OTS EXCEPT WITH PCL, AVBL FM 0100-1300Z DAILY.
RWY 12/3 0 RY 12/30, THRESHOLD LGTS & EDGE LGTS OTS EXCEPT WITH PCL, AVBL FM 0100-1300Z DAILY.
